二、分区存储管理 把整个内存划分为若干大小不等的区域,操作系统占用一个区域,其它区域供系统中的多个进程共享,这种方法称为分区存储管理。这是最简单的一种存储管理,按分区划分的时机可分为固定分区和动态分区。 固定分区:把内存固定地划分为若干个大小不等的区域。适用于作业大小和出现频率均已知的情况。此...
段式存储的优/缺点:有效减少了外部碎片,但是段长仍是可变的,无法完美的嵌入内存空间,仍存在外部碎片。 因此,存储管理引入页式存储,进程空间分成一模一样大小的块,内存也分成对应大小的页,进程按页存储,完美占用内存的一页,外部碎片就消除了。 2.页式存储 页帧(Frame):物理地址空间的一页 页面(Page):逻辑地址空...
百度试题 结果1 题目操作系统的存储管理是指( )。 A. 硬盘空间管理 B. U盘管理 C. 内存管理(正确答案) D. 文件管理 相关知识点: 试题来源: 解析 C. 内存管理 ( 正确答案 ) 反馈 收藏
存储管理地主要目的是解决多个用户使用主存地问题,主要包括分区存储管理、分页存储管理、分段存储管理、段页式存储管理以及虚拟存储管理。 2.1、分区存储管理 分区存储管理是早期地存储管理方案,其基本思想是把主存的用户区划分成若干个区域,每个区域分配给一个用户作业使用,并限定它们只能在自己的区域中运行,这种主存分配方案...
分区管理方案时满足多道程序运行最简单的存储方案。 思想:内存划分成若干连续区域(分区);每个分区装入一个程序。 一、固定分区 1.思想 将内存分为若干大小固定,大小可以不同的分区;划分好之后,系统运行期间不再重新划分。 每个分区划分好之后大小固定;因此可容纳的程序的大小就有限制;程序也必须提供对内存资源的最大...
Lecture3-存储管理 存储管理是操作系统的重要组成部分,负责管理计算机系统的重要资源——内存储器。 内存空间一般分为两部分 系统区:存放操作系统内核程序和数据结构等。 用户区:存放应用程序和数据。 存储管理包括以下功能: 存储分配:位进程分配内存空间以便运行,完成内存区的分配和去配工作。 地址映射:内存被抽象...
分区式存储管理是把内存分为一些大小相等或不等的分区,操作系统占用其中一个分区,其余的分区由应用程序使用,每个应用程序占用一个或几个分区。 1 划分内存分区的方法 1)分区大小相等 内存分区大小一致,可能浪费空间;也可能空间不够。 2)分区大小不等 含较多的较小分区、适量的中等分区和少量的大分区。
存储管理的任务包括内存分配、内存保护、内存回收等,通过有效的存储管理可以充分利用系统的存储资源,提高系统的运行效率和性能。 二、内存层次结构 1、主存储器 主存储器是计算机系统中最主要的存储器,它用于存放正在运行的程序和数据,是CPU直接访问的存储器。主存储器一般被划分为若干个固定大小的块,每个块被称为一...
在动态分配内存时,操作系统必须对其进行管理。一般而言,有两种方式跟踪内存使用情况:位图、空闲链表。 位图 对所有的内存划分成小到几个字,达到几千字节的分配单元。每个分配单元对应于位图中的一位,0表示空闲,1表示占用。这样在决定把一个占k个分配单元的进程调入内存时,存储管理器必须搜索位图,在位图中找出有k个...
虚拟存储技术 基本思想:利用大容量的外存来扩充内存,产生一个比有限的实际内存空间大得多的、逻辑的虚拟内存空间,简称虚存。 操作系统把程序当前使用的部分保留在内存,而把其他部分保存在磁盘上,并在需要时在内存与磁盘之间动态交换。支持多道程序设计技术。